Output e7660bda3d8ce7c1aac10d2de25b8cd665fc5204bc1dfd11c413587de2b51d2f:1

value
197572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06312fe6667fd024a33d89148522e855bfd23bf5 OP_EQUAL
address
32FkuGuPUHKbbM2kQpuRutPcidCDGvzxaY
transaction
e7660bda3d8ce7c1aac10d2de25b8cd665fc5204bc1dfd11c413587de2b51d2f
spent
true